Monastery Run Wetland 1, near Latrobe, Pennsylvania, was built in 1997-1998 as a passive treatment system for several discharges from an abandoned underground mine. Adequate retention time for iron removal from mine water before discharge to Four Mile Run is provided by the use of settling ponds and wetlands. The Office of Surface Mining Reclamation and Enforcement (OSMRE) and the Pennsylvania Department of Environmental Protection (PA DEP) investigated the system to identify reasons for enhancing its treatment performance.
